nothing I tried changed my NAT to open until I followed the steps recommended by this site :)
basically after trying all the complicated stuff like port fowarding and putting my xbox in a dmz (which is surprisingly tricky with the homehub), I found that simply setting all the I.P.s, gateways and subnet masks and stuff to auto on the xbox, telling the homehub to use the same I.P. address every time for my xbox, and assigning the application "XBconnect" to my xbox's I.P., it mysteriously started working again (go to the website as I cant be bothered to run through it all here)
sometimes the simplest solutions are the best :)
